The Dark History of Misleading Ingredients

Imagine replacing traditional fats used for cooking with trans fats, which were widely accepted without any safety studies. This monumental blunder took decades to correct, and the consequences still impact our health today.

Consider substances like asbestos, or the pesticide DDT—both once marketed as safe and effective, only for lengthy public outcry to reveal their dangerous effects. This pattern isn’t unique; it underscores a significant issue in our society, as evidenced by the overwhelming examples of harmful products introduced under the guise of safety.
